ROS路由器配置OpenVPN实现安全外网访问的完整指南

dfbn6 2026-05-21 半仙VPN 1 0

作为一名网络工程师,在日常工作中,我们经常需要为用户搭建稳定、安全且易于管理的远程访问方案,近年来,越来越多的企业和个人用户希望通过OpenVPN这类开源协议来实现对境外资源的合法访问(如海外服务器、云服务或特定业务平台),而RouterOS(ROS)作为MikroTik路由器的操作系统,因其强大的功能和灵活的脚本支持,成为许多高级用户的首选工具,本文将详细介绍如何在ROS路由器上部署OpenVPN服务,以实现安全、高效的外网访问。

确保你的路由器硬件支持OpenVPN,MikroTik的大多数现代设备(如hAP AC²、RB2011、CCR系列等)均内置OpenVPN模块,无需额外购买硬件即可完成部署,登录到ROS WebFig或WinBox界面后,进入“IP > OpenVPN”菜单,点击“Server”标签页,选择“Create New Server”。

第一步是生成证书,OpenVPN依赖于PKI(公钥基础设施)进行身份验证,因此必须先创建CA(证书颁发机构)、服务器证书和客户端证书,使用ROS自带的证书管理工具(/certificate)生成CA证书,然后基于CA签发服务器证书,这一步非常重要,它决定了整个OpenVPN连接的安全性,建议设置合理的过期时间(如365天),并启用自动续签机制。

第二步是配置OpenVPN服务器参数,在“Server”配置中,指定监听端口(默认1194)、加密方式(推荐AES-256-GCM)、认证方式(建议使用TLS-Auth密钥增强安全性)以及DH参数长度(通常2048位),设置本地子网(如10.8.0.0/24),这是客户端连接后获得的IP地址池,启用“Allow Local Network Access”可让客户端访问局域网内的其他设备(如NAS、打印机等),但需谨慎授权。

第三步是创建客户端配置文件,使用ROS的“Export”功能导出客户端配置(.ovpn文件),其中包含CA证书、客户端证书、TLS密钥等信息,你可以手动编辑此文件,添加诸如“redirect-gateway def1”选项,使所有流量经由OpenVPN隧道转发,从而实现“刷外网”效果,需要注意的是,该选项会强制客户端所有互联网请求通过VPN出口,避免泄露真实IP地址。

第四步是防火墙规则配置,在“IP > Firewall > Filter Rules”中添加允许OpenVPN端口(1194/TCP)的入站规则,并限制仅允许特定IP段访问,在“NAT”规则中启用源地址转换(masquerade),确保客户端流量能正确路由回公网。

测试与优化,在Windows、Mac或移动设备上导入.ovpn文件,连接成功后,可通过访问ipinfo.io或whatismyipaddress.com确认当前公网IP是否已变为OpenVPN服务器所在位置,若出现延迟高或丢包问题,可调整MTU大小(通常设为1400)或启用UDP协议(比TCP更高效)。

通过上述步骤,你可以在ROS路由器上搭建一个稳定、安全的OpenVPN服务,不仅满足“刷外网”的需求,还能用于企业分支机构互联、远程办公等多种场景,务必注意遵守当地法律法规,合理使用网络资源,避免非法访问行为,掌握这项技能,将极大提升你在网络架构设计中的专业能力。

ROS路由器配置OpenVPN实现安全外网访问的完整指南

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N